Serves 5

  1. Grind all pepper to Garlic with little vinegar. Marinate the pork with the above masala paste, remaining vinegar and salt for at least one hour

    Ask a question about this step
  2. Heat oil in a pan add chopped onion ,whole chilies, coriander powder and Sauté for 2 minutes

    Ask a question about this step
  3. Add the meat and fry for few more minute then add ½ a cup of hot water. Cover and cook in low heat until the pork is tender

    Ask a question about this step
  4. Serve with boiled beetroots slices
